I was on the subway last night when I saw this old couple who looked to be in their late 60s. The guy looked drunk and sleeping. What I noticed about them was that they looked very sweet because the man’s hand was on his wife’s thigh while her hand was on his thigh. A little while later, the guy shifted a bit and their hands changed into holding hands position but then the guy put his other hand on the thigh of the woman on his other side. His wife was laughing softly as she got hold of both his hands. I guess the old guy was really out of it. Maybe he had one too many sojus. Then another old man who also had more soju that he can take almost fell over on his way to the door because he stumbled on the crossed leg of the sleeping old man. There are really a lot of drunk people on the subway especially Friday and Saturday nights.

Being a construction worker is usually hazardous to one’s health, especially if one is working in a developing country. Safety belts and hard hats are not the norm. One can see these workers hanging out of rickety looking scaffoldings with no safety mechanisms that will protect them from a fall. Although big construction companies are now investing in safety products for their workers, there are still companies who do not or cannot do so. Aside from such obvious risks, there are not so obvious ones, like unknowingly being exposed to carcinogenic materials like asbestos. Asbestos poisoning causes mesothelioma; which is a cancer of the membranes that surround vital body organs. It is sad how these workers are exposed to such risks just so that they can earn mere pittance to support their family. Employers should be careful about their workers health and ensure their safety by providing proper safety equipment.
